build: retire FACET argument to genfacetimpl

This commit is contained in:
Roland Conybeare 2026-03-11 10:03:46 -05:00
commit 5f33b643c2

View file

@ -37,7 +37,6 @@ xo_add_genfacet(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-symboltable-localsymtab
FACET_PKG xo_expression2
FACET SymbolTable
# REPR LocalSymtab
INPUT idl/ISymbolTable_DLocalSymtab.json5
)
@ -46,7 +45,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-localsymtab
FACET_PKG xo_alloc2
FACET GCObject
# REPR LocalSymtab
INPUT idl/IGCObject_DLocalSymtab.json5
)
@ -55,7 +53,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-localsymtab
FACET_PKG xo_printable2
FACET Printable
# REPR LocalSymtab
INPUT idl/IPrintable_DLocalSymtab.json5
)
@ -66,7 +63,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-symboltable-globalsymtab
FACET_PKG xo_expression2
FACET SymbolTable
# REPR GlobalSymtab
INPUT idl/ISymbolTable_DGlobalSymtab.json5
)
@ -75,7 +71,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-globalsymtab
FACET_PKG xo_alloc2
FACET GCObject
# REPR GlobalSymtab
INPUT idl/IGCObject_DGlobalSymtab.json5
)
@ -84,7 +79,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-globalsymtab
FACET_PKG xo_printable2
FACET Printable
# REPR GlobalSymtab
INPUT idl/IPrintable_DGlobalSymtab.json5
)
@ -106,7 +100,6 @@ xo_add_genfacet(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-constant
FACET_PKG xo_expression2
FACET Expression
# REPR Constant
INPUT idl/IExpression_DConstant.json5
)
@ -115,7 +108,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-constant
FACET_PKG xo_alloc2
FACET GCObject
# REPR Constant
INPUT idl/IGCObject_DConstant.json5
)
@ -124,7 +116,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-constant
FACET_PKG xo_printable2
FACET Printable
# REPR Constant
INPUT idl/IPrintable_DConstant.json5
)
@ -135,7 +126,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-variable
FACET_PKG xo_expression2
FACET Expression
# REPR Variable
INPUT idl/IExpression_DVariable.json5
)
@ -144,7 +134,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-variable
FACET_PKG xo_alloc2
FACET GCObject
# REPR Variable
INPUT idl/IGCObject_DVariable.json5
)
@ -153,7 +142,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-variable
FACET_PKG xo_printable2
FACET Printable
# REPR Variable
INPUT idl/IPrintable_DVariable.json5
)
@ -164,7 +152,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-typename
FACET_PKG xo_alloc2
FACET GCObject
# REPR Typename
INPUT idl/IGCObject_DTypename.json5
)
@ -173,7 +160,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-typename
FACET_PKG xo_printable2
FACET Printable
# REPR Typename
INPUT idl/IPrintable_DTypename.json5
)
@ -184,7 +170,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-varref
FACET_PKG xo_expression2
FACET Expression
# REPR VarRef
INPUT idl/IExpression_DVarRef.json5
)
@ -193,7 +178,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-varref
FACET_PKG xo_alloc2
FACET GCObject
# REPR VarRef
INPUT idl/IGCObject_DVarRef.json5
)
@ -202,7 +186,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-varref
FACET_PKG xo_printable2
FACET Printable
# REPR VarRef
INPUT idl/IPrintable_DVarRef.json5
)
@ -213,7 +196,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-defineexpr
FACET_PKG xo_expression2
FACET Expression
# REPR DefineExpr
INPUT idl/IExpression_DDefineExpr.json5
)
@ -222,7 +204,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-defineexpr
FACET_PKG xo_alloc2
FACET GCObject
# REPR DefineExpr
INPUT idl/IGCObject_DDefineExpr.json5
)
@ -231,7 +212,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-defineexpr
FACET_PKG xo_printable2
FACET Printable
# REPR DefineExpr
INPUT idl/IPrintable_DDefineExpr.json5
)
@ -242,7 +222,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-applyexpr
FACET_PKG xo_expression2
FACET Expression
# REPR ApplyExpr
INPUT idl/IExpression_DApplyExpr.json5
)
@ -251,7 +230,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-applyexpr
FACET_PKG xo_alloc2
FACET GCObject
# REPR ApplyExpr
INPUT idl/IGCObject_DApplyExpr.json5
)
@ -260,7 +238,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-applyexpr
FACET_PKG xo_printable2
FACET Printable
# REPR ApplyExpr
INPUT idl/IPrintable_DApplyExpr.json5
)
@ -271,7 +248,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-lambdaexpr
FACET_PKG xo_expression2
FACET Expression
# REPR LambdaExpr
INPUT idl/IExpression_DLambdaExpr.json5
)
@ -280,7 +256,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-lambdaexpr
FACET_PKG xo_alloc2
FACET GCObject
# REPR LambdaExpr
INPUT idl/IGCObject_DLambdaExpr.json5
)
@ -289,7 +264,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-lambdaexpr
FACET_PKG xo_printable2
FACET Printable
# REPR LambdaExpr
INPUT idl/IPrintable_DLambdaExpr.json5
)
@ -300,7 +274,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-ifelseexpr
FACET_PKG xo_expression2
FACET Expression
# REPR IfElseExpr
INPUT idl/IExpression_DIfElseExpr.json5
)
@ -309,7 +282,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-ifelseexpr
FACET_PKG xo_alloc2
FACET GCObject
INPUT idl/IGCObject_DIfElseExpr.json5
)
@ -317,7 +289,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-ifelseexpr
FACET_PKG xo_printable2
FACET Printable
INPUT idl/IPrintable_DIfElseExpr.json5
)
@ -327,7 +298,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-expression-sequenceexpr
FACET_PKG xo_expression2
FACET Expression
INPUT idl/IExpression_DSequenceExpr.json5
)
@ -335,7 +305,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-gcobject-sequenceexpr
FACET_PKG xo_alloc2
FACET GCObject
INPUT idl/IGCObject_DSequenceExpr.json5
)
@ -343,7 +312,6 @@ xo_add_genfacetimpl(
xo_add_genfacetimpl(
TARGET xo-expression2-facetimpl-printable-sequenceexpr
FACET_PKG xo_printable2
FACET Printable
INPUT idl/IPrintable_DSequenceExpr.json5
)